17 Morven St, Maclean is a 3 bedroom, 1 bathroom House with 1 parking spaces and was built in 1910. The property has a land size of 266m2 and floor size of 113m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in November 2017.

Rose Cottage is located in a fantastic position in the heart of town. The cottage is set on a perfect sized 266m2 low maintenance block and provides a welcoming ambiance.
The home has three bedrooms and a separate lounge room while the kitchen is tidy with several original cupboards, electric stove plus ample room for a large dining table. Other features include high ceilings, air conditioning, a front verandah which is a lovely place to relax and soak in the morning sun while the new rear pergola provides excellent outdoor living space.
The size of Maclean is approximately 9.8 square kilometres. It has 13 parks covering nearly 4.9% of total area. The population of Maclean in 2016 was 2628 people. By 2021 the population was 2778 showing a population growth of 5.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Maclean is 60-69 years. Households in Maclean are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Maclean work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 64.40% of the homes in Maclean were owner-occupied compared with 61.10% in 2016.
